Obama Announces Locke For Commerce Secretary
Even though Gary Locke is his third choice, President Obama calls him the right man for the job.
The former Washington governor is now officially the nominee for Commerce Secretary. The President made the announcement Wednesday morning in Washington, D.C.
Barak Obama: “So Gary will be a trusted voice in my cabinet, a tireless advocate for our economic competitiveness and an influential ambassador for American industry who will help us do everything we can especially now to promote our industry around the world.”
Washington is often called the most trade dependent state in the nation.
As Governor from 1997 to 2005, Locke led highly-publicized trade missions to China and other countries. Since leaving office he’s worked on trade issues for a private law firm.
Locke is the administration’s third choice to run the Commerce Department. Two previous nominees bowed out.
